Transaction 581e3d6d3f874605cec8fb017d492d05b52a87ca80aaed45ba916ae5af098448
1 Input
1 Output
-
581e3d6d3f874605cec8fb017d492d05b52a87ca80aaed45ba916ae5af098448:0
- value
- 2627580
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2667d35430ddf51e51b8e2715078bf13e7cae386 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14W54DJAuEPpo3sVgMtXyyCTiCXfMWGaEL